RACER PARKING
We are going to go back to having everyone park in the main pit area as we did in Year 1. All parking over on Sandy Beach is dedicated solely to MOTORHOMES only. Parking of larger trailers and toterhomes in the pits will be designated to maximize space in the pit area so as not to create the parking fiasco from the first year.

Yes there should be a formal race circular but this race is being organized by people with day jobs so my apologies for the information coming out in chunks as it is...
Race Particulars
Entry Fees are as Follows:
Inboard / Inboard Endurance: $85.00 per day / $65.00 per day (2nd Class / Step-up)
SST45: $85.00 per day
45SS / Stock Outboard: $65.00 per day / $55.00 (2nd Class / Step-up)
Car Entry into Bonelli Park and Spectator Fees
$10 per car load County Gate Fee per day
$10 Admission to the Races per day
Wearing of proper spectator wristbands will be strictly enforced. If you are not wearing a wristband you will be asked to put it on or pay the admission fee and given one to wear.
Motorhome Parking / Camping
$75.00 for the weekend - All at Sandy Beach Area Only
First come first serve basis
Designated Pit Parking:
Ok, you got to work with us here on this, here is how it needs to go...
Toter home type vehicles pulling large trailers, large trailers pulled by trucks etc. will be directed to park on the right side parking lot which we called VENDOR'S ROW. If your vehicle and trailer qualify for this designated parking, then you will be directed to park there. PLEASE DO NOT ASK ME WHAT THE SIZE LIMITS ARE FOR THIS DESIGNATED PARKING BECAUSE I DON'T KNOW!! LOL.. you will find out when you get there.
For the most part, the rest is open parking. Please be aware of the amount of space your team will be occupying to avoid overcrowding or being asked to consolidate your area if the pit area becomes too full.
